When you lie down among the sheepfolds, the wings of the dove are covered with silver and with glittering gold.
When the Sovereign One scatters kings, let it snow on Zalmon!
The mountain of Bashan is a towering mountain; the mountain of Bashan is a mountain with many peaks.
Why do you look with envy, O mountains with many peaks, at the mountain where God has decided to live? Indeed the LORD will live there permanently!
God has countless chariots; they number in the thousands. The Lord comes from Sinai in holy splendor.
You ascend on high, you have taken many captives. You receive tribute from men, including even sinful rebels. Indeed the LORD God lives there!
The Lord deserves praise! Day after day he carries our burden, the God who delivers us.(Selah)
